Contemporary Romance Book Review: Julia Monroe Begins Again


About the Book

Title: Julia Monroe Begins Again 

Series: Beignets for Two, Book 1 

Author: Rebekah Millet 

Genre: Contemporary Romance 

Publisher: Bethany House Publishing 

Release Date: October 24, 2023

Publisher's Book Description

"Julia Monroe has just turned forty and has high hopes for a fresh start after the last decade of her life abruptly left her a young widow and a single mom. With both her boys off to college, she can finally focus on expanding her New Orleans-based cleaning business. Julia is ready for new beginnings--but God has other plans. Samuel Reed, the ruggedly handsome Green Beret who shattered her heart over twenty years ago, has returned to town and is the kind of distraction she never saw coming. 

 

After their first interaction in years leaves her mind spinning and her emotions out of control, Julia knows she needs to avoid him if she wants any chance of preventing history from repeating itself, but her meddling best friend keeps throwing them together. And now it seems inevitable that the man who was hard to forget might just be impossible to resist."

My Review

Julia Monroe Begins Again, by Rebekah Millet, is a delightfully witty contemporary novel full of heartwarming scenes and plenty of sweet romance. From beginning to end, this book offers a satisfying blend of drama, emotion, and humor. With characters who are authentic and vulnerable, and a setting that is altogether engaging, this book is truly enjoyable. Featuring relevant themes of family, forgiveness, and second chances, this story is genuinely touching and thoughtful.  

 

New Orleans is the ideal setting for a novel that captivates with moving story elements like good friends, complex family dynamics, small business opportunities, and fresh starts. A quaint book and bakery shop is the opportune place for many important scenes. Add various homes and a church, and there are several meaningful spaces from which the story can easily unfold. 
 

The appealing characters in this book are also quite special. Though they experience heartache and uncertainty, they dare to take risks, share their vulnerabilities, and overcome their insecurities. With honesty, perseverance, and courage, they endeavor to heal from hurt and rejection as they pursue wholeness and acceptance. They learn the value of faith, forgiveness, and trust as they pursue their hearts’ desires.
 

Ms. Millet’s debut novel is a stunning achievement! She has succeeded in writing a story that is uplifting and very entertaining. Julia Monroe Begins Again is certainly memorable and inspiring. It is a terrific novel that is very worthwhile, and I recommend it wholeheartedly.

About the Author: Rebekah Millet

Rebekah Millet is a Cascade Award and ACFW First Impressions Award–winning author of contemporary Christian romance novels. A New Orleans native, she grew up on beignets and café au lait, and loves infusing her colorful culture into her stories. Her husband is an answer to prayer, who puts up with her rearranging furniture and being a serial plant killer. Her two sons keep her laughing and share in her love of strawberry Pop-Tarts.” --Biography from Rebekah Millet’s author page on Amazon.com.
